Duncan Lake (British Columbia)
Duncan Lake is a man-made reservoir lake in the Kootenay region of British ColumbiaCanada, formed by Duncan Dam and about 45 km in length. It is fed by the Duncan River, which forms part of the boundary between the Selkirk Mountains to the west and the Purcell Mountains to the east. Below Duncan Dam is the head of Kootenay Lake.
